New Set-up Help

Status
Not open for further replies.

hol9798

New Member
Nov 30, 2020
4
0
1
47
Hi All,
I have experience with Nortel PBX and Comdial (pseudo)PBX and have also set-up a 3CX then Asterisk/FreePBX for home use. I have heard good things about FusionPBX and wanted to give it a spin, again for home use. for my Asterisk config I am using Analog PSTN, GV via Obihai devices and SIP trunking from Bulkvs. I also have an Avaya 9611 and 9641 using SIP and Panasonic TGP-600 system. This far, I am able to register a softphone and a line on the TGP600 to FusionPBX- can make calls to/from one another and to system resources (i.e. clock). I have added BulkVS as a gateway and it shows "REGED". I created an Outbound route for BulkVS for Toll free numbers (I use a few different ANI Verification numbers for testing). When I dial ANY 800 number, I get a fast busy. I'm wondering if I missed a step, as it doesn't seem to be making an attempt to hit BulkVS. I've attached logs from my latest test call.

I would truly appreciate it if someone could help point me in the right direction.
 

Attachments

  • freeswitch.txt
    43.9 KB · Views: 12

Adrian Fretwell

Well-Known Member
Aug 13, 2017
1,498
413
83
The problem may be with your inbound route (destination), from what I can see the inbound number is not being matched hence you get a 480.
Code:
dd8a3c93-a4e8-4b16-879a-8a62cb1067c4 Dialplan: sofia/internal/340@172.16.3.10 parsing [172.16.3.10->BulkVS.91800445566778829d6] continue=false
dd8a3c93-a4e8-4b16-879a-8a62cb1067c4 Dialplan: sofia/internal/340@172.16.3.10 Regex (PASS) [BulkVS.91800445566778829d6] ${user_exists}(false) =~ /false/ break=on-false
dd8a3c93-a4e8-4b16-879a-8a62cb1067c4 Dialplan: sofia/internal/340@172.16.3.10 Regex (FAIL) [BulkVS.91800445566778829d6] destination_number(18004444444) =~ /^9(\+?1)?(8(00|44|55|66|77|88)[2-9]\d{6})$/ break=on-false
 

DigitalDaz

Administrator
Staff member
Sep 29, 2016
3,070
576
113
It appears you have created an outbound route that requires a prefix of 9 which is then stripped off.
 

hol9798

New Member
Nov 30, 2020
4
0
1
47
Thank you both @DigitalDaz and @Adrian Fretwell.

I originally created two outbound routes - one with a 9 prefix and one without. To simplify troubleshooting, I deleted both and recreate one route for toll Free using the dial plan match pattern as ^1?(8(00|33|44|55|66|77|88)[2-9]\d{6})$. and added "1" as the outbound prefix (my BulkVS account is configured for 11 digits)

This helped. I now see the call being sent to BulkVS and am getting the following:

1fd0acaa-d8de-4a48-b209-494735235db8 2020-12-08 13:30:25.883805 [NOTICE] sofia.c:8559 Hangup sofia/external/18004444444 [CS_CONSUME_MEDIA] [CALL_REJECTED]

I am assuming this is now a config mis-match between my system and BulkVS, and have submitted a ticket with them. If anyone suspects something else, please let me know...

Thanks again for the help! I hope in a few months when I get everything rolling I can "Pay it forward".
 

hol9798

New Member
Nov 30, 2020
4
0
1
47
As an update - BulkVS confirmed it was a configuration setting - our registration timer was set too high and the reg was expiring.
 

ict2842

Member
Mar 2, 2021
140
11
18
Wichita, KS
Hey @hol9798! I am trying to set things up with BulkVS as awell. After getting my IP whitelisted, I was able to get the gateway registered. When I make an inbound or outbound call, I get the same busy tone. If you don't mind, I have a few questions on the setup.

Is the below timing configuration for the gateway correct?
Are you using SMS?

1614970683383.png

Edit: Inbound is now working.
 
Last edited:

DigitalDaz

Administrator
Staff member
Sep 29, 2016
3,070
576
113
Inbound doesn't need a gateway and no, that timer is way to low, push it up to 120 at least, currently that expire 25 is going to have your gateway reregistering about every 12-30 seconds.
 

ict2842

Member
Mar 2, 2021
140
11
18
Wichita, KS
Thank you. I increased that limit to 120. The reason I had 25 was my understanding from the image below.
I did get inbound running. Till I get everything functioning, I want to keep things basic and slowly expand it into queues, IVRs, time conditions, etc.
I resolved the outbound thanks to 480 Temporarily Unavailable | FusionPBX Forums. It seems I am up and running in terms of voice!

1614993725574.png
 
Last edited:

DigitalDaz

Administrator
Staff member
Sep 29, 2016
3,070
576
113
Maybe it should be set to that, that is a ridiculously low timer though, I have never seen one so low, nor can I fathom any reason for needing it. I';d say leave it at 120 if it works.

Do they have any similar documentation for how you should send outbound traffic. In particular, the format for dialling, whether they want, rpid or pid etc.
 

ict2842

Member
Mar 2, 2021
140
11
18
Wichita, KS
Oddly enough, when I changed it to 120, outbound (not internal) calls would drop after 10/11 seconds of being connected. I switched it back and was able to get a call to last longer (after 40 seconds I hung up) and then it returned to dropping the calls.

I followed Outbound calls drop ACK not received | FusionPBX Forums (except for external IP addresses) and then reverted the changes because I got a 488 error. Somehow it works, I'll accept it.
1615041605248.png
 
Last edited:
Status
Not open for further replies.